Show: Locust , R.Harris Engineer: Leo del Aguila Date: October 16-23, 2004 Dub 2 master 1 (tape 1 cont and tape 2 short) 3:13 RH there are dead ones also on the road 3:17 Leo- why don't you pick one up and describe it for me, just for fun. RH- laughter, yeah, this one is dead, or almost dead, this one's twitching, yuck I think you can just grab it that would be a good photo actually RH 3:42 I picked up a locust that was lying on the road, almost dead, still twitching a little bit. So the farmer had told us they had come through to spray a couple of days ago, so this may be the result of insecticide on this critter, he's about three inches long with silvery black wings. His legs are pink and his eye is red and his face is uh, sort of silvery with some black markings on it also, and it looks like kind of a creepy little creature in a way. He looks armored and is actually reminiscent of the grasshopper of some of those animated movies. They are not portrayed very flattering in the movies either. He has 4:53 on the trailing edge of his little hopping legs he has a trail of little spurs and they continue on sort of the foot on the end of that....anyway. for, want to hold him? 5:33 (digital camera click) 6:23 RH we are not walking up to another field that is just dirt. There is nothing in it at all. There are a couple of wells, one on each end and one in the middle. There is just nothing growing. There is one small row of green something. That's it for this whole field. RH Who's field is this? 6:52 BOY15yrs? this is my uncle's farm. RH And was he growing something? 7:06 yes he has grown something, but locust ate up everything. Rh just a few plants left in the middle, what are those? 7:19 that is cucumbers, but its not growing yet. RH cucumbers but it hasn't- BOY-Cucumbers but it hasn't grown yet. Its cassava. RH Normally what would be growing here right now? 8:09 at this time, it would be, cropping carrots. RH And your uncle decided not to plant carrots either this season? 8:34 he will be cropping. RH- he will be? What was destroyed in these fields? 8:52 it was peppers and tomatoes. 9:00 RH there's a beautiful bird- and interesting bird coming across. Very large. 9:08 RH Have you had locust here before 9:15 BOY- it has been a while, they didn't destroy. 9:23 RH-When was that? Do you remember when that was? 9:32 BOY-1988 RH-and why didn't they destroy the crops that time? 9:42 BOY-They did not stay a long time, but once they came the sprayer came and destroyed. This time was different 10:04 this time it was different, they are more locusts, they are laying in here and in 88 they weren't laying in here. 10:25 this time there are more locusts and instead of 1988 this time they are laying eggs in here. 10:40 RH Have they come to spray these fields also 10:43 Yes they came once 10:50 RH Did it help? 10:54 yes when they sprayed, they killed all the eggs, but once they went another generation came back but no one sprayed them. 11:23 you will find more over there. 1:40 you will find more red locust over there, they are eating the small one RH what are they eating? 11:56 RH they are eating the smallest ones?
